What do we mean by “intelligence?” I’ve known any number of people in my life who struggled in school, couldn’t read, and were worse spellers than I am. And yet, they could fix an old tractor out in the field with just a pair of pliers and a screwdriver while I struggle to fix the carburetor on my mower, even with the help of a YouTube video. So, who’s the intelligent one?

We know humans are intelligent, but how smart are non-humans? I guess we could start by looking at brain size. As you would guess, whales have the biggest brains…sperm whales to be exact. On land, elephants have the largest brains. Both are smart, but maybe there is a better way to measure intelligence than just brain size alone. Maybe instead of size, we should look at the ratio of the size of the brain to the size of the animal. In that case, the animal with the largest brain-to-body ratio is an ant! Are ants intelligent?

There should be a better way? There is; it is called the E.Q. (encephalization quotient), which looks at how big the brain is compared to how big a brain an average animal that size is expected to have. The animals with the highest E.Q. are… #1 humans, #2 dolphins, and #3 chimpanzees. The human brain is 7.4 times larger than expected in an animal our size. The dolphin’s brain is 5 times larger, and the chimp’s is 2.5 times larger.

Are you aware that there are about 20 different species of jumping spiders in Nebraska? Is that an abrupt change from talking about intelligence? No.

Jumping spiders are the most intelligent spiders in the world, and one of the most intelligent of those is the bold jumping spider, which lives right here in central Nebraska. These spiders have tremendous eyesight, they go through elaborate mating dances, and as their name suggests, they can jump…up to 40 times their body length. For a human, that would be longer than a football field!

They don’t build webs but ambush their prey by leaping and catching them. Jumping spiders, like all spiders, have eight eyes; four are front-facing, with the middle, larger two providing high-resolution color vision, and they are telescopic. They don’t adjust a lens to focus on things at different distances like our eyes; instead, the retina moves. On either side of the larger eyes are lateral eyes that function in distance perception, and the tracking of objects. The other four eyes detect motion all around the spider.

But how smart are they? What is their E.Q.? It is small compared to humans, only about 0.4. But then most invertebrates don’t have high E.Q.’s. In a previous column, I wrote about Marcellus, the giant Pacific Octopus from the movie “Remarkably Bright Creatures,” and about how intelligent octopi are. Octopi have an E.Q. that is the same as that of the bold jumping spider!

Maybe we can’t interact with octopi here in central Nebraska, but we can interact with something every bit as intelligent! The bold jumping spider!
